This review is about a nail product that I recently discovered... I love my nails; they are long and don't break too often. Usually I cut them relatively short, but that's where the care often ends - being a busy mom, I have absolutely no time waiting for a nail polish to dry! And let's face it, if you want a nice manicure that will stay there for longer than a day before chipping, you have to put on 2 coats. And if the colour is in the dark shades, you want to use a base coat + top coat. So that's 4 coats of polish that have to dry! What mother has got time for that? Not this one!

So the product is Sally Hansen 14-day Nail Shield:



Why I love it? Well, all you have to do it wash & dry your hands and then buff your nails. Then you peel off the backing (okay, this can be a little tricky, but not really) and stick it on your nail slowly and carefully making sure that there are no air bubbles. Cut off the excess and file away any little nits. That is all and voila, you got yourself a nice sheer and very even (no streaks) manicure!

Now, will it last 14 days? My guess is YES. Why only a guess - well, my nails grow so quickly that I cannot wear any nail polish for longer than 1 week before the bottom of the nail starts to peek through... It's a similar thing with this product - it's been 8 days and the only thing that's apparent is my nail grow. Other than that - no chips, no peeling off and no cracking! And I've washed my hair, scrubbed dishes and baby bottles.
